TABS Model of the Lake Pontchartrain Estuary
Lake Pontchartrain Estuary, Louisiana
FTN modeled the Lake Pontchartrain and adjacent Gulf of Mexico estuary area using the TABS-MD modeling system (RMA-2 and RMA-4) for the Louisiana Department of Natural Resources. The purpose of hydrologic modeling study was to investigate methods to optimize salinities near Bayou LaLoutre for oyster production.Modeling included the investigation of several scenarios including:
- Three diversion scenarios from the Bonnet Carre Spillway,
- the placement of gates on the Mississippi River Gulf Outlet of the downstream end, and
- a diversion canal including channel design with gates near Violet Canal.
Each of the scenarios had to be checked to ensure velocities were not exceeded for safe navigation in the area. FTN accomplished the modeling of this system and these scenarios in the extremely short 24-day period required by the state, especially since simulation times themselves took 24 days. This required modification of the RMA-2 source code to eliminate screen updates and recompilation for optimization on FTN's workstations.Program output was displayed using the TABS-MD graphical routines including vector plots, concentration contours, and film loops of the plots and contours.
